Students should take a minimum of 7 IGCSE (International General Certificate of Secondary Education) subjects over two years during their final stage. Most of the students take 10 IGCSE subjects, which is comparable to the level provided at top British and international schools around the world. At least one subject from each group must be chosen. If a student studies at least 7 subjects and a minimum of 2 subjects from group 1, for which an ICE (International Certificate in Education) award certificate in connection with exam registration may be applied.

The Cambridge ICE is a group award designed for schools that want to offer a broad curriculum in India. 90- 95 percentage is considered for A* in IGCSE. For more information on the grades read the article.
